Assignez un logiciel à un coeur du double-proccesseur
Proposé par adriweb
| Posté le Mercredi 22 Août 2007 à 12h | Visité 683 fois
| 5 commentaires
Si vous avez un ordinateur avec un processeur double-coeur, vous pouvez forcer un programme à s'exécuter sur un seul processeur et non pas les deux (ici, l'exemple sera avec MsPaint). Ainsi, le second sera libre et pourra faire tourner d'autres programmes.
Voici la manipulation à effectuer :
-> Cliquez sur l'orbe (bouton Vista) puis sur Tous les programmes -> Allez dans les propriétés de l'application de votre choix ->Dans le champ Cible, remplacez tout ce qui précède le nom du programme par Cmd /C start /affinity 0 sans les guillemets, en respectant les espaces (exemple : Cmd /C start /affinity 0 mspaint.exe).
Utilisez le chiffre 0 pour affecter le programme au coeur 1 et le chiffre 1 pour l'affecter au coeur 2. Cliquez sur Appliquer puis sur OK.
Vous pouvez aussi ajuster par ce biais la priorité du programme : du plus lent au plus rapide :
/Low
/Normal
/High
/Realtime
/Abovenormal
/Belownormal
L'icône de votre programme va etre changée par cette manipulation.
En savoir plus sur adriweb
Il est passionné par tout ce qui touche aux nouvelles technologies, Internet, l'informatique ... C'est aussi un webmaster (http://www.adriweb.net). C'est un lycéen de 15 ans, rédacteur sur VistaRC, qui souhaite travailler dans l'informatique/intelligence artificielle.
#1 fg
Sinon, si on veut gérer ça en dynamique, il suffit de suivre la manipulation suivante :
- Ctrl+Alt+Suppr
- Gestionnaire de tâche (s'il n'est pas déjà ouvert)
- Onglet processus
- Clic droit sur le processus que vous souhaitez assigner sur un coeur spécifique
- Définir l'affinité
- Cochez seulement le CPU sur lequel vous souhaitez assigner le processus.
#2 adriweb
exact ! mais faut le faire @ chaque fois ! (ben oui, sinon ca s'appellerait pas "dynamique" ^^)